Pathways of activation and change of the endocrine function of testes elicited by effect of presence of the female
Authors:T. G. Amstislavskaya  A. V. Osadchuk  E. V. Naumenko
Affiliation:Laboratory of the Genetic Bases of Neuroendocrine Regulation of the Institute of Cytology and Genetics, Siberian Division, Academy of Sciences, USSR, Novosibirsk.
Abstract:
1. The presence of a receptive female elicits a maximal rise, governed by the synchronous augmentation of its biosynthesis in the male sex gland, in the level of T in the blood plasma and testes in male mice within 20–40 min. Blood T and its production by the testes become normalized by the 80th minute, whereas normalization of its content in the male sex gland takes place later.
2. The activating effect of the presence of a receptive female on the blood level of T is achieved with the involvement of luliberin receptors by the transadenohypophyseal pathway, since a luliberin antagonist completely blocks this effect.
